How they compare

Czechia currently reports 301 t against 183 t in India, a difference of 118 t.

That makes Czechia's figure about 1.6 times India's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 21 shared years of data; in 1998 it was India ahead.

Czechia ranks 19th and India ranks 22nd of 63 countries.

India has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
